Macedonia - Renewable Energy Supply (Excluding Solid Biofuels)

Since 2014, Macedonia Renewable Energy Supply (Excluding Solid Biofuels) jumped by 9.7points year on year. At 6.97 Percent of Total Primary Energy Supply in 2019, the country was ranked number 49 comparing other countries in Renewable Energy Supply (Excluding Solid Biofuels). Macedonia is overtaken by Cyprus, which was ranked number 48 with 7.27 Percent of Total Primary Energy Supply and is followed by Bosnia and Herzegovina at 6.75 Percent of Total Primary Energy Supply. Iceland ranked the highest with 89.78 Percent of Total Primary Energy Supply in 2019, that is an increase of 1.6points compared to 2018. Paraguay, Norway and Tajikistan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Yemen witnessed the best average annual growth at +142.2points per year, while Togo recorded the worst performance at -23.1points per year.
